IMMEDIATE CONTROL
immediate control. Criminal procedure.
1. The area within an arrestee’s reach. ? A police officer may conduct a warrantless search of this area to ensure the officer’s safety and to prevent the arrestee from destroying evidence. [Cases: Arrest 71.1(5); Automobiles 349.5(10). C.J.S. Arrest ¡ì¡ì 70¨C71.]
2. Vehicular control that is close enough to allow the driver to instantly govern the vehicle’s movements. ? A driver’s failure to maintain immediate control over the vehicle could be evidence of negligence.
